Lady Eagles defeat Argyle
By Phil Major | Published Thursday, September 24, 2009
Friday's battle of top-rated volleyball teams in Decatur turned into a clinic by the Lady Eagles. Decatur swept Argyle 25-23, 25-20, 25-13.

Coach Claire Rose's concern about a homecoming letdown were quickly dispatched as Decatur played its game, allowing very few free balls, attacking the Argyle defense and keeping rallies alive.

"The team did a great job of keeping them out of system, not allowing their big hitters to do any damage," Rose said. Decatur's setters and hitters did a great job moving the ball around, Rose said, keying off a good defensive effort from the back row.

Sara Oxford led the front line assault with nine kills and seven blocks. Kortney Tompkins slammed eight kills and blocked three shots. Ingrid Boatman had six kills and three blocks. Fleming Smurthwite blocked three to go with five kills. Ciara Currin blocked seven and killed two, and Kortni Robinson blocked six with two kills.

Smurthwaite put up 21 assists and Joey Redwine five.

Oxford and Tompkins served two aces each.

Oxford dug out 13 Argyle attempts, Tompkins 11, Smurthwaite nine, Carmen Cash six, Lynzee Jordan five, Robinson four and Claribel Trejo and Boatman three each.
